What is under canopy lighting?

Under canopy lighting is the use of LED bars positioned beneath the plant canopy to deliver light directly to lower growth zones.

Typical setup:

  • LED bars placed under the canopy

  • Height: 15–30cm below foliage

  • Spacing: 60–90cm apart

  • Used alongside full-spectrum top lighting

This method is now widely used in commercial greenhouse and indoor cultivation across Australia, particularly where consistency and efficiency matter.

The problem: uneven light distribution

Without under canopy lighting:

  • Upper canopy receives most of the PPFD

  • Lower branches sit in shadow

  • Energy is wasted on unproductive growth

This leads to:

  • Heavy lollipopping

  • Smaller lower fruit/flower

  • Inconsistent plant development


The advantages of under canopy lighting

1. More PPFD to lower branches

Instead of wasting light at the top:

👉 You deliver usable light where it’s needed most

  • Improved photosynthesis across the whole plant

  • Better utilisation of plant structure


2. Less lollipopping required

With proper light distribution:

  • Lower growth becomes productive

  • Less pruning labour

  • More retained sites


3. Easier trimming and harvest workflow

Uniform development = efficiency

  • Less low-quality material

  • Cleaner processing

  • Reduced labour at harvest


4. Consistent fruit/flower size across the plant

This is where serious growers see real gains.

  • Even development from top to bottom

  • More uniform output

  • Higher quality end product

👉 Not just more yield—better yield
